Vinyl fence repl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or outdated fencing and installing new vinyl fencing to enhance privacy, security, and curb appeal. This process typically includes assessing the existing fencing, removing the existing structure, preparing the ground, and carefully installing the new vinyl panels and posts. Many local contractors ensure that the replacement fence is installed securely and accurately, providing a long-lasting barrier that requires minimal upkeep. This service is a practical solution for homeowners seeking a durable, low-maintenance fencing option that can withstand various weather conditions.

The overview below groups typical Vinyl Fence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or vinyl fence repairs, such as replacing a few panels or posts,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of a vinyl fence or repairing multiple panels can cost between $1,000 and $2,500. Larger, more complex partial replacements tend to push costs toward the upper part of this range.
Full Fence Replacement - A complete vinyl fence installation usually cost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Most projects in this category fall into the middle to upper part of this range, depending on size and customization needs.
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ive fence replacements or custom designs can exceed $10,000, with some high-end or very large projects reaching $15,000 or more. These higher costs are less common and typically involve complex features or large proper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. An experienced contractor should be able to provide detailed descriptions of the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ant warranties or guarantees.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and establishes a transparent foundation for the project. When reviewing options, it’s beneficial to ask for written estimates or proposals that outline the specifics, so there’s a clear basis for comparison.
